Hacksneck, Accomack County

Hacksneck, located in Accomack County, Virginia, is a small unincorporated community that offers residents and visitors a quiet and peaceful retreat. Nestled along the Chesapeake Bay, Hacksneck is known for its scenic beauty, charming communities, and friendly atmosphere.

Accomack County, situated on the eastern shore of Virginia, is well-known for its coastal landscapes, abundant wildlife, and rich history. As one of the oldest counties in the United States, Accomack County is steeped in tradition and has a unique cultural heritage. Visitors to the area can explore the Historic Records Center to learn about the county’s rich history, or take a walking tour of the charming downtown area.

Hacksneck itself is a small community with a population of around 100 residents. The area is primarily residential, with a mix of historic homes and newer constructions. Hacksneck offers a peaceful and serene living environment, with its picturesque views of the Chesapeake Bay and surrounding countryside. The community is known for its close-knit nature, and residents often gather for community events and social gatherings.

For outdoor enthusiasts, Hacksneck and the surrounding areas offer a wide range of recreational activities. The Chesapeake Bay is a popular spot for boating, fishing, and crabbing, with many residents and visitors enjoying the calm waters and abundant marine life. The nearby Magothy Bay Natural Area Preserve is a great place to hike, bird watch, and explore the unique wetland ecosystems.

For those seeking a taste of the local cuisine, there are several restaurants and seafood markets in the area that offer fresh and delicious seafood dishes. From steamed crabs to grilled fish, visitors can enjoy the flavors of the Chesapeake Bay right from their plate.

Hacksneck is conveniently located near several larger towns and cities, making it easy to access amenities and services. The town of Exmore, just a short drive away, offers shopping centers, grocery stores, and restaurants, ensuring that residents have all they need within reach. The city of Virginia Beach, with its pristine beaches and vibrant culture, is also within driving distance for those looking for a day trip or weekend getaway.
